Mare de Deu de Montserrat, Montferri, Tarragona

Mare de Deu de Montserrat Montferri, or Sanctuary of the Virgin of Montserrat, a sanctuary and hermitage built 1926-28 and again from 1987, at Montferri, Tarragona, Catalonia, Spain. The church was designed by Josep Maria Jujol in local sand and cement, but when funds ran out the project was finished in the early 1990s by Joan Bassegoda i Nonell and Josep Cendros, and finally inaugurated in 1999. The building has been called the other Sagrada Familia because of its organic forms and parabolic arches. Picture by Manuel Cohen
